First Aid Instructor Transfer Option 2

The Canadian Red Cross First Aid & CPR Instructor Transfer Option 2 course focuses on the specific skills of the core Red Cross First Aid Program, and instructor candidates will learn to teach Emergency First Aid, Standard First Aid, Marine Basic First Aid, Emergency Child Care First Aid, Standard Child Care First Aid and CPR courses.

This course includes Stepts 1, 2 & 3 as outlined below. You will still need to complete a Teaching Experience before becoming fully certified.

First Aid Instructor Transfer Option 2

Canadidates with previous experience as a Canadian Red Cross Water Safety Instructor/Instructor Trainer or who are an educator (elementary or secondary level) will follow the Instructor Development Pathway above, however they will not be required to complete the in-class component of Step 2.

STEP 1: EVALUATE SKILLS AND CHECK PREREQUISITES

Instructor candidates must be 18 years or older and have a valid Standard First Aid participant certificate. The first day of the course will be a First Aid & CPR Instructor skills evaluation with a Teaching Experience Supervisor or Instructor Trainer.

STEP 2: FUNDAMENTALS OF INSTRUCTION

The next step in the instructor pathway is the Fundamentals of Instruction course, which consists of an 8-hour online module followed by a 2-day in-class module. Transfer Option 2: If you are currently a Red Cross Water Safety Instructor, you will skip the in-class portion of this course, but will still need to complete the 8-hour online module. 

STEP 3: FIRST AID & CPR DISCIPLINE-SPECIFIC

The First Aid & CPR Discipline-Specific module consists of two days in class and microteach assignments that you'll receive ahead of time.

STEP 4: TEACHING EXPERIENCE

The last step in the certification process is to complete a Teaching Experience online module (30-45 min) and a classroom component with the support of a Teaching Experience Supervisor.

STEP 5: CERTIFICATION

Once certified as an instructor, you will need to work with a Red Cross Training Agency to process participant certifications.

Full Course Length 24 hours
